Aaron and Austin Keeling direct and co-write with Natalie Jones. Emily Goss (who we had the joy of interviewing), Taylor Bottles, and Cathy Barnett star.
The film arrives on iTunes, Amazon Instant Video, Google Play, VUDU, Xbox, and PlayStation come September 30th.
Synopsis: The story revolves around Jennifer (Emily Goss). She is seven months pregnant and reluctantly returning to her hometown in Kansas. She has just had an unexpected mental breakdown. Coping with her fears of motherhood; a strained relationship with her husband, Luke (Taylor Bottles); and the overbearing presence of her own mother, Meredith (Cathy Barnett), Jennifer struggles to regain control of her life. But, when strange things start happening in their new rental home, Jennifer begins to fear that it may be haunted. Alone in her convictions, Jennifer is forced to question her sanity as she attempts to find out what, if anything, is plaguing the house.
